XML in Office 12 Beta Promises Easy Reading

Friday, November 18th, 2005

Desktoppipeline is reporting the Office 12 Early Beta is being sent out to beta testers right now.
Code-named Microsoft Office 12, it features a significantly redesigned user interface, many new server- and client-based functionalities, and the default use of XML-based file formats for all its applications.

New Podcasting Search Engine

Wednesday, November 9th, 2005

Add this to your list of RSS tools. Feedster, a great place to go to see who is linking to your site, is now offering podcast search.  A podcast icon, ala iTunes, shows up if the item in your search results is a podcast.
